Output 050a59f3d9f5c85517e2f1525f83627d42626aa0def1ce4dfda7553c5b0e0f7f:0

value
156289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cb338f9203724fb8106f75065abe2c8f5621315 OP_EQUAL
address
32rAjSscRz3MQhE3qPbXSM2HAptuNQ2Skm
transaction
050a59f3d9f5c85517e2f1525f83627d42626aa0def1ce4dfda7553c5b0e0f7f
confirmations
50445
spent
true